4. Invite Your Neighbors

Inviting neighbors to your open house can increase traffic and sell the home. Real estate has a 10, 10, 20 rule. When you get a listing, knock on ten houses on each side and twenty across the street. In condos, slip a flyer under the front door, which includes an invitation and QR code.

Most towns allow residents to eliminate large, bulky, or complex items on designated days of curbside clean-up (also known as bulk trash pickup).

And if you're living where this is implemented, here's how you can get the most out of it.

Don't Miss It

Find out the day when bulk trash pickup occurs. Some municipalities hold one monthly while others host spring or fall annual or biannual events. Meanwhile, larger cities may plan two or more local curbside clean-up days. 

Once you find out when yours takes place, set a reminder on your calendar so you won't miss it.

Segregate What You Can (And Can't) Put Out

The "what" is almost as crucial as the "when" regarding bulk trash day information. There are a lot of different regulations about what your community will accept. Some things are widely considered acceptable (carpets, lamps, swing sets), some are typically prohibited (propane tanks, concrete, hazardous chemicals, and many are in between -- which means others may allow them but others won't (small appliances, batteries, yard waste). Organizing Your Home Improvements

Research and prepare before pulling apart a property to restore. Check local housing prices to see what buyers would pay and ROI. Therefore, check local home valuations and sales. After understanding the local real estate market, you must have home improvements. Work with a Realtor who knows your neighborhood to make wise renovation decisions. 

What Home Improvements Should Be Done First?

Whether you're doing a major or minor project, these seven home improvements will increase your property's value.

  1. Upgrade The Kitchen For The Greatest Value

Kitchens are vital for real estate investors trying to increase property value. It holds particular areas in people's hearts—a warm, inviting kitchen calls to us on some level.

Fully Renovated: Consider whether the floor plan is modern or efficient before removing all cabinets and fixtures in a complete renovation. Before buying granite or marble counters, try quartz or synthetic stones.

Specific Updates: Kitchen renovation ROI may be low. Consider darker stainless steel for a bolder design. Compare appliances with "provable" efficiency claims. A kitchen with old but serviceable cabinetry can be revived with paint. 

  1. Bathroom Finishes, Fixtures, And Efficiency

Bathrooms show age second only to kitchens, and they always figure on lists of the most valuable home improvements.

Fully Renovated: Installing water-efficient and space-saving sinks and toilets can free up a room. Replace linoleum with sharper flooring to improve. Replacing the shower tile and tub can brighten a dull bathroom.

Specific Updates: Upgrade faucets, knobs, and other sink and bathroom fixtures. Another inexpensive upgrade that may transform a bathroom is cabinetry hardware. Home improvements can be cost-effective without a sophisticated updated floor plan or flashy installations. 

  1. New Flooring And Paint May Increase A Home's Value

Updates like new paint and flooring may seem simple, but they can increase your home value. The most significant effects are sometimes achieved with the simplest upgrades.

Fully Renovated: Some older homes have carpet and aged flooring. Wood is attractive, but you have other options. Bamboo flooring costs less and looks identical. Painting the whole house may renew it.

Specific Updates: Consider installing carpeting instead of hardwood or bamboo flooring in the upper level of your home if you conclude that new flooring is required.

Celebrities And Their Real Estate Portfolio

Leonardo DiCaprio

Leonardo DiCaprio

DiCaprio has come far from his modest Los Angeles childhood home. He started his profession at age five and has a net worth of $260 million. DiCaprio loves real estate and spends his riches on it. A Hollywood star has five California homes and many Manhattan luxury condos. 

His properties include a $5.2 million Palm Springs midcentury-modern, a $2 million Hollywood Hills home formerly owned by Madonna, a $23 million Paradise Cove home, and a $13.8 million Malibu oceanfront house.

In 2021, DiCaprio sold his historically significant Los Feliz home for $4.9 million to Los Angeles native Miguel. Later that year, he paid Jesse Tyler Ferguson $7.1 million for Gwen Stefani's Los Feliz home and a $10 million Beverly Hills residence. He lives in a four-parcel, three-house property on Bird Streets in the Hollywood Hills with Madonna's former home. 

Taylor Swift

Taylor Swift

As far as we know, Taylor Swift has eight residences totaling at least $84 million in real estate spread over four states. For $1.99 million in 2009, Taylor bought a 3,240-square-foot Music Row condo worth $3 million. She purchased a $2.5 million Nashville Forest Hills estate two years later. 

She bought a $3.55 million Beverly Hills Cape Cod home in 2011. Her 2012 purchase was a $1.78 million single-story property with a pool, 1,000-bottle climate-controlled wine cellar, courtyard, and garden. The Grammy winner bought a $17.75 million 12,000-square-foot property in Watch Hill, Rhode Island, in 2013 and a $20 million duplex penthouse in Tony Tribeca in 2014. 

Finally, Swift bought a $25 million Beverly Hills property in 2015. An $18 million townhouse and a $9.75 million condo were purchased by the megastar in 2017 next to her double penthouse. The celebrity properties assets amount to about $47.7 million on this particular Tribeca block alone.

Jeff Bezos

Jeff Bezos

The former Amazon CEO Jeff Bezos is the world's wealthiest at $140 billion. He has invested millions in a large real-estate portfolio from Washington to New York City. Jeff Bezos bought three adjacent New York City apartments for $80 million in June 2019, two months after his divorce from MacKenzie. 

Bezos has two 5.3-acre Medina, Washington houses. His first home, a 20,600-square-foot, cost $10 million in 1998. A $53 million 8,300-square-foot house is the other. For $24.45 million in 2007, Bezos bought a Spanish-style property, and after ten years, he acquired a "modest" 4,568-square-foot house next door for $12.9 million since this estate was too small. 

In 2020, Bezos bought the Warner Estate, which was created for former Warner Bros. executive Jack Warner. He paid $165 million for the 9-acre, most costly property in Los Angeles. Another 30,000-acre ranch is owned by Bezos 30 miles outside Van Horn, Texas. For $23 million in 2016, Bezos bought an old DC textile museum.
